Quality Control in Practice
The cheapest quality control step is a retained sample. Keeping three sealed units from every butterscotch ice batch costs almost nothing and turns any dispute into a simple comparison instead of an argument over photographs.

How Butterscotch Ice Fits the Assortment
Butterscotch Ice rewards retailers who can explain it in one sentence. If your team needs a paragraph, the range is too complicated for the space it occupies.
Before anything else, decide which customer you are buying butterscotch ice for. A convenience counter with limited shelf depth needs a tight range that turns quickly, while a specialist shop can carry a deeper ladder of options and educate buyers into higher ticket lines.

Logistics That Protect Margin
Consolidating butterscotch ice with other lines is often the biggest single saving available to a mid size importer. The unit cost does not change but the landed cost does, sometimes materially.

What if a batch does not match the sample?
Keep the retained samples from the approval stage. If a delivered batch measurably differs, we compare against the retained set and resolve it against the production record. This is why we insist on sealed retained units from every run.

How should butterscotch ice be stored?
Cool, dry and out of direct sunlight. Heat and light are the two things that shorten shelf life fastest. Rotate stock by batch code rather than by arrival date, and keep cartons off concrete floors in humid warehouses.
